- Bangalore Water Supply and Sewerage Board’s (BWSSB) water supply system supplies water to around 63 lakh people. The water scarcity can be resolved by:
- Recycling sewage water (will provide water for about 12 lakh people)
- Storing surface run-off water in tanks.
- Plugging leakages in the water supply system
Since the surface of Ponniyar and Arkavathy is rocky, rainwater cannot infiltrate and should therefore be stored in tanks. Silt must be cleared to improve capacity. Bangalore city has lost around 70% of its lakes and water bodies. Groundwater is being continuously abused, and this soon may result in its complete loss as infiltration of rainwater is around 6%. Groundwater in the Hebbal area was found to be around 4,000 years old.
